Pacific Grinning Tun
DESCRIPTION
A solid, glossy with a short spire and about seven whorls, with a globose body whorl and shallow suture. Aperture is narrow; the thichkened outer lip bears inwardly poiting, elongated teeth crowded toward the base. Lower half of columellar twinsted fold; above are four to five small folds; siphonal notch is broad and slightly recurved. Creamy brown, bloumella with pale brown and white; lip and columella white.
